**Leadership Review Briefing – Inventory Write-Down**

For heads of department. We will record a write-down on obsolete Kestrel-line components held at the Darnfield warehouse, roughly 3% of total inventory value. Root cause: the mid-cycle redesign made older housings unusable. Disposal and salvage options are being costed. The item below provides confidential context for planning purposes.

management briefing: Project Ulavan slips by two quarters because of the staffing delay.

MEMO — Spare parts shipment for the Karvig Ridge relay station. Shift lead: please stage the pallet from bay C containing two Torvane pump impellers, four sealed bearing kits, and the replacement control board for the Ellstrom unit. Each item is bagged with desiccant; do not break the seals, as the site has no clean area for repacking. Helmark Transport collects at 06:30 and will not wait past 07:00. At hand-over, the driver is required to state the following authorisation phrase:

courier memo of yawep-yafog: the pramir ulaix courier leaves the ulavan aldix frair zorok oliiel joreth rusdor fenvan ledger at gate 1305 under passcode 514738

Subject: Handover — encoding detection for uploads

Hi Varla,

Taking over from me on the Textflume intake service: uploaded text files run through the charset sniffer before insert. Most misdetections are UTF-16 files without a BOM; the fallback table logs these with a confidence score. If support escalates a garbled-file ticket, check the sniffer_log table first, then re-run detection manually. The staging database you'll need is reachable with the connection string below.

replica DSN, yahog-kawig: redis://istox_svc:um@db-8a67.halixforge.test:5432/frawyn